** The bathroom remodeling market for Greeley, Nebraska, is intrinsically linked to the larger Grand Island area. As a rural community, Greeley itself does not host specialized bathroom remodeling contractors. Therefore, residents typically rely on established companies from Grand Island, which is approximately a 30-45 minute drive away and serves as the regional commercial center. The competition level is moderate, with a handful of well-regarded, long-standing contractors dominating the high-quality renovation space. These providers are typically family-owned or local franchises with strong community ties and reputations built over decades. The market is not saturated with national chains, which favors personalized service and local accountability. Typical pricing for a full bathroom remodel in this region can range from **$10,000 for a basic update** (new fixtures, vanity, flooring) to **$25,000 - $40,000+ for a high-end, full-gut renovation** with custom tile work, layout changes, and accessibility features. The quality of work is generally high, with contractors emphasizing durability and timeless design to meet the needs of a practical, family-oriented market. Homeowners are advised to obtain multiple quotes and verify licensing and insurance directly with any contractor before proceeding.

In Greeley and the surrounding Nebraska area, a full bathroom remodel typically ranges from $10,000 to $25,000+, depending on the scope and material choices. Key local cost factors include the availability and transportation of materials to our rural location, the age of your home (which may require updating plumbing to meet current codes), and the choice between regional contractors versus larger companies from Grand Island or Kearney. Labor costs can also vary seasonally based on local demand.
Greeley's climate makes proper insulation and ventilation critical. We recommend investing in a high-quality exhaust fan to manage summer humidity and prevent mold, and ensuring all exterior walls are well-insulated to prevent frozen pipes in winter. For flooring, materials like porcelain tile are excellent for handling temperature fluctuations, while avoiding certain solid wood vanities that can crack in our dry winter air is a wise local consideration.
Yes, most structural, plumbing, and electrical work in Greeley requires a permit from the City of Greeley or Nance County. Local regulations will enforce the Nebraska Uniform Plumbing Code and National Electrical Code. It's crucial to hire a contractor familiar with these local permit processes, as requirements for septic systems (common in rural areas) or historical home updates can have additional stipulations.
The ideal time is late spring through early fall. This avoids the deepest winter freeze, which can complicate material deliveries and make it difficult for contractors to work if your home needs ventilation. A typical full remodel takes 3 to 6 weeks. Scheduling well in advance is key, as local quality contractors in our smaller community often have booked schedules several months out.
